Reviewed Blackberry Jalapeno Glazed Pork Tenderloin

"Wow!! This recipe is probably the best tasting pork tenderloin I've ever had. Moist and tender from the brine, sweet and spicy, not dry. Cooked it on the grill to a light pink stage. I don't like my pork tenderloin well done. I'll probably make it with 2 peppers next time. Roasting the jalapeno mellows out the spicyness. I also noticed that on Guy's video he mixed the cornstarch with red wine, not red wine vinegar as shown on the recipe. I mixed the cornstarch with the red wine and added a tbls. or red wine vinegar to this. "
